    Younis Khan Appointed Afghanistan’s Mentor for ICC Champions Trophy

    The Afghanistan Cricket Board (ACB) on Wednesday designated previous Pakistan captain Younis Khan as the guide for the national group for the coming ICC Champions Trophy.

    According to an ACB media discharge, the previous hitter will go with Afghanistan amid their conditioning and planning camp in Pakistan, advertising his mentorship administrations until the conclusion of the eight-nation ICC event.

    The 47-year-old Younis amassed 10,099 runs a Pakistan record at a sound normal of over 52 in 118 Tests. 7,249 runs in 265 ODIs and 442 runs in 25 T20 Internationals.

    The right-hander scored the foremost Test centuries (34) for his nation whereas his career-best 313 against Sri Lanka in a 2009 Test at Karachi lifted him to the number one position within the ICC rankings.

    Naseeb Khan, the chief official of the ACB, said that ACB was satisfied to sign a contract with Younis as intervals guide of the national group for the Champions Trophy which is able be arranged from Feb 19 to Walk 9.

    Since the Champions Trophy is being held in Pakistan, it was required to allot a gifted and experienced player as mentor from the facilitating nation. We as of now had effective involvement with facilitating countries tutors within the 2023 ODI World Container and the 2024 T20 World Container. Watching the conditions, subsequently, we have designated Younis Khan as coach for our national group for the up and coming mega occasion and wish him best of the good fortune in his pivotal assignment, Naseeb was cited in a discharge from ACB as saying.

    The Champions Trophy is returning after more than seven a long time. The occasion will include 15 matches within the 50-over organize and will be held over Pakistan and Dubai. The past version finalists, India and Pakistan, are planned to confront on Feb 23 in Dubai.

    Rawalpindi, Lahore and Karachi will serve as the three scenes for the occasion. Each setting will organize three group matches with Lahore facilitating the moment semi-final.

    Lahore is set to host the ultimate on Walk 9 unless India qualify, in which case the ultimate will be played in Dubai. Both the semi-finals and the ultimate will have save days.

    Pakistan will confront Unused Zealand within the Gather opener in Karachi on Feb 19.

    The Dubai leg will start the another day, with India taking on Bangladesh. Afghanistan dispatch their campaign at the Champions Trophy on Feb 21 against South Africa in Karachi.
